Hormones are chemical messengers that regulate various bodily functions, including mood, appetite, metabolism, digestion, sleep, and reproduction. In humans, hormones play an essential role in sexual behavior and reproduction, affecting libido, sexual arousal, orgasm, and even parenting behaviors. Natural hormonal rhythms can be described as fluctuations in hormone levels that occur at specific times during the day or month.
Testosterone peaks in men in the morning and declines throughout the day, while estrogen levels rise during ovulation and fall afterward in women. These hormonal changes can have significant effects on sexual desire and behavior.

Natural hormonal rhythms play an important role in enhancing bonding in couples over time. Oxytocin is one of the main hormones responsible for bonding between partners. It is released during physical contact, such as hugging or cuddling, and promotes feelings of attachment and trust. This hormone also helps regulate sexual arousal and orgasm, which can lead to increased intimacy and closeness between partners.
